Significant ROI and High Rental Yields

Dubai provides some of the highest rental yields, frequently between 5% and 8%, when compared to many other cities throughout the world. Compared to major real estate markets like London, New York, and Hong Kong, this is far higher. Dubai’s position as a major business and tourism hub, drawing professionals, entrepreneurs, and expats from all over the world, is the main factor driving the strong demand for rental homes.

Additionally, due to capital appreciation, Dubai property investments can produce substantial profits. Property values frequently rise as the city expands and develops, making it a profitable long-term investment. Particularly promising for capital gains are regions that are experiencing substantial infrastructural construction and development.

A Robust and Open Regulatory Structure

A stringent regulatory system protects both buyers and investors in Dubai’s real estate industry. Property transactions are supervised by the Real Estate Regulatory Agency (RERA) and the Dubai Land Department (DLD), which guarantee justice and openness. Because it lowers the possibility of fraudulent activity and encourages ethical behaviour, this regulatory structure aids in preserving investor confidence.

Another example of protecting investors is the implementation of escrow accounts for off-plan properties. In order to guarantee that funds are utilised exclusively for project completion, developers must deposit money into these accounts. For investors considering Dubai property investments, this gives an additional level of security.

Alluring Payment Schedules and Off-Plan Possibilities

The availability of enticing payment plans, especially for off-plan constructions, is one of the special benefits of Dubai property investments. Numerous developers provide flexible payment plans that let investors make payments over time in installments rather than all at once. This eases financial strain and increases accessibility to real estate investing.

Since investors can buy off-plan properties at a discount before completion, they can provide high return potential. Property values frequently rise as demand increases and improvements are completed, giving investors the opportunity to sell at a profit or take advantage of strong rental yields.

Benefits for Businesses and a Tax-Free Lifestyle

Dubai provides other financial benefits, such as no income tax for people, in addition to the lack of property taxes. High-net-worth individuals, businesses, and expatriates are drawn to this tax-free environment, which raises demand for residential and commercial real estate.

Dubai’s free zones, which offer benefits including 100% foreign ownership, no corporation taxes, and complete profit repatriation, are also advantageous to enterprises. The population is growing and jobs are being created thanks to this economic framework, which also makes the real estate market stronger.
